diff options
| author | mo khan <mo@mokhan.ca> | 2025-06-09 19:42:35 -0600 |
|---|---|---|
| committer | mo khan <mo@mokhan.ca> | 2025-06-09 19:42:35 -0600 |
| commit | fb2f93e6c675cd7e309c7fa1a91afa06f3ba9965 (patch) | |
| tree | c2dcac3500ba76c6787802bef28dbd294b5a33f6 /src | |
| parent | 1b280d0b9be71daf9dffa0f4fa33559eda91946f (diff) | |
Rename RegisteredClient to OAuthClient
Diffstat (limited to 'src')
| -rw-r--r-- | src/clients.rs |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/src/clients.rs b/src/clients.rs index 38d7450..8ee16f7 100644 --- a/src/clients.rs +++ b/src/clients.rs @@ -5,7 +5,7 @@ use std::collections::HashMap; use uuid::Uuid; #[derive(Debug, Clone, Serialize, Deserialize)] -pub struct RegisteredClient { +pub struct OAuthClient { pub client_id: String, pub client_secret_hash: String, pub redirect_uris: Vec<String>, @@ -23,7 +23,7 @@ pub struct ClientCredentials { } pub struct ClientManager { - clients: HashMap<String, RegisteredClient>, + clients: HashMap<String, OAuthClient>, } impl ClientManager { @@ -51,7 +51,7 @@ impl ClientManager { redirect_uris: Vec<String>, client_name: String, scopes: Vec<String>, - ) -> Result<RegisteredClient, String> { + ) -> Result<OAuthClient, String> { // Check if client_id already exists if self.clients.contains_key(&client_id) { return Err("Client ID already exists".to_string()); @@ -67,7 +67,7 @@ impl ClientManager { // Hash the client secret let client_secret_hash = Self::hash_secret(&client_secret); - let client = RegisteredClient { + let client = OAuthClient { client_id: client_id.clone(), client_secret_hash, redirect_uris, @@ -85,7 +85,7 @@ impl ClientManager { Ok(client) } - pub fn get_client(&self, client_id: &str) -> Option<&RegisteredClient> { + pub fn get_client(&self, client_id: &str) -> Option<&OAuthClient> { self.clients.get(client_id) } @@ -164,7 +164,7 @@ impl ClientManager { }) } - pub fn list_clients(&self) -> Vec<&RegisteredClient> { + pub fn list_clients(&self) -> Vec<&OAuthClient> { self.clients.values().collect() } } |
